find the circumference of the object. use 3.14 or \\(\frac{22}{7}\\) for \\(\pi\\). round to the nearest hundredth if necessary.
circumference: about \\(\square\\) cm
Step1: Identify the formula for circumference of a circle
The formula for the circumference \( C \) of a circle is \( C = \pi d \), where \( d \) is the diameter. From the diagram, the diameter \( d = 6 \) cm.
Step2: Substitute the values into the formula
We can use \( \pi = 3.14 \). So, \( C = 3.14\times6 \).
Step3: Calculate the result
\( 3.14\times6 = 18.84 \) cm.
